Your Safety Footwear: A Overview of Protection
Keeping your feet safe is essential in the workplace. Whether you're laboring in a factory, construction site, or other hazardous area, heavy-duty safety footwear can make the difference between a minor accident and a serious one. These shoes are designed to withstand harsh conditions and offer superior protection for your lower extremities.
A good pair of safety footwear should be resistant to impact, puncture, and compression. Choose footwear with a steel toe cap to shield your toes from falling objects or heavy equipment. The sole should also be non-slip here to prevent falls on slippery surfaces.
Opt for footwear that is comfortable well and allows for adequate flexibility. Make sure to inspect your safety footwear regularly for any signs of wear and tear.

Step Up Your Safety: Essential Features of Top Safety Shoes
When it comes to your job, safety shouldn't be a priority – it should be your top priority. That's where top-quality safety shoes come in. These aren't just any footwear; they are specially crafted to shield your feet from a range of potential dangers on the job site. So, how do you identify the best safety shoes for your work environment? Look for these essential characteristics:
- Durable Construction: Safety shoes should be made from heavy-duty materials that can withstand the rigors of your workplace.
- Protective Toes: These provide a vital barrier against heavy impacts.
- Traction Soles: Keep your feet firmly planted on wet surfaces to prevent injuries.
- Puncture Resistant Features: These can include special inserts in the soles or midsoles to protect your feet from sharp objects or heavy blows.
